My understanding is there wasn't a Royal New Zealand Navy Flag in WW2.
New Zealand, Canada and Australia all used the White Ensign until well into the 1960's. Indeed when WW2 started the Royal New Zealand Navy didn't even exist. It was The New Zealand Division of the Royal Navy. So if you're being pedantic at the Battle of the river Plate it was HMS Achilles not HMNZS Achilles. Having said that I don't think anyone objects to her being called HMNZS and it wouldn't be wise to mention it in front of her crew!
